dental fibres <dentistry> The processes of the pulpal cells, the odontoblasts, which extend in radial fashion through the dentin to the dentoenamel junction and are contained within the dentinal tubules.
The intertubular fine collagenous fibre's that with the dentinal ground substance infiltrated with calcium salts constitutes the dentinal matrix.
Synonym: Tomes' fibres.

dental fissure <dentistry> Deep grooves or clefts in the surface of teeth equivalent to class 1 cavities in black's classification of dental caries.

dental fistula <dentistry> A sinus tract originating in a peripheral abscess and opening into the oral cavity on the gingiva.

dental follicle <dentistry> The dental sac with its enclosed odontogenic organ and developing tooth.

dental forceps <dentistry> Forceps used to luxate teeth and remove them from the alveolus.
Synonym: extracting forceps.

dental furnace <dentistry> A furnace used to eliminate the wax pattern from the investment mold prior to casting in metal, a furnace used to fuse and glaze dental porcelains.

dental geriatrics <dentistry> Treatment of dental problems peculiar to advanced age.
Synonym: gerodontics, gerodontology.

dental germ The collective tissues from which an entire tooth is formed, including the dental sac, enamel organ, and dental papilla.

dental granuloma Chronic nonsuppurative inflammation of periapical tissue resulting from irritation following pulp disease or endodontic treatment.

dental groove A transitory depression in the gingival surface of the embryonic jaw along the line of ingrowth of the dental lamina.

dental health services Services designed to promote, maintain, or restore dental health.

dental health surveys A systematic collection of factual data pertaining to dental or oral health and disease in a human population within a given geographic area.

dental hygienist A licensed, professional auxiliary in dentistry who is both an oral health educator and clinician, and who uses preventive, therapeutic, and educational methods for the control of oral diseases.

dental hygienists Persons trained in an accredited school or dental college and licensed by the state in which they reside to provide dental prophylaxis under the direction of a licensed dentist.
